Transaction d35ea672703895094f980c989a963d53c626ebbb4b32847b5faa373dd61a2f59

1 Input
2 Outputs
  • d35ea672703895094f980c989a963d53c626ebbb4b32847b5faa373dd61a2f59:0
  • value  314887
    address  34HasvkZ69XakQ3umtL3yTPbgzrrV1Qqnw
  • d35ea672703895094f980c989a963d53c626ebbb4b32847b5faa373dd61a2f59:1
  • value  1228976801
    address  3AQ4kUjQaDjCjmDh2ojKEHjUKTSi52UUqD